The maximum amount you might acquire to have an unsecured loan are based on how higher the debt-to-money proportion could well be adopting the loan is made.

Imagine if you are searching for financing that have a payment off $495, and you also currently have $1,700 with debt payments monthly. The financial institution can add the fee away from $495 with the most other monthly installments out of $step one,700, getting all in all, $dos,195. Now, let’s imagine you have got a month-to-month money from $5,000. The lender tend to separate $2,195 because of the $5,one hundred thousand — while making nearly 44%. Odds are, a legitimate lender will not make that loan you to definitely pushes you into the a good DTI of 49%. You should try using a DTI regarding forty% or lower than.

In the event that bringing acknowledged to possess a consumer loan is going to push you over you to line, you should know adjusting the quantity, repaying obligations, otherwise prepared unless you is actually earning more cash.

What is the difference between pre-qualification and you can pre-approval?

In the event that a lender tells you that you’re pre-eligible to financing, that implies they thinks you could get from the acceptance processes. In the event the a lender tells you you might be pre-recognized, it has given a good conditional commitment to offer the financing. Beware: Some lenders make use of these terms and conditions interchangeably. If someone else tells you you are either pre-qualified otherwise pre-acknowledged, ask them precisely what they suggest.

  1. You happen to be pre-eligible for financing as well as have an idea of simply how much you could potentially use
  2. You give adequate economic guidance to become pre-acknowledged
  3. The lending company operates a difficult credit check and you may tells you when the you may be needless to say obtaining the mortgage

During pre-qualification, the financial institution will provide you with an idea of how much might be eligible for and you will just what interest rate tends to be. Pre-recognition happens when the lender sometimes cost you documentation out-of work, income, and you can identification. Provided absolutely nothing bad appears before you could intimate for the mortgage, just be good to go.
